## Hot-Reloading Config — Quickstart

Welcome aboard! The Lanternly gateway watches `conf.d/` and reloads on save — no restart needed. Just don't hot-reload the TLS block; that one needs a full bounce. To push a config through the reload endpoint from your laptop, use the internal key below.

app token of badug-tahaf = qvz11-nP5FBNr8qnh

## Local Setup — User Module Split

We're extracting the user module from the Brindlecore monolith into its own service. Run the extraction shim, then start both processes; the shim proxies legacy calls. Migrations live in `/migrations/user-split`. Apply them before first boot. The standalone user service needs its own database; point it there with the connection string below.

primary connection of yagep-kahip = redis://giliel_svc:zYiKsLL2PLpfPL@db-348f.xolmarsys.corp:5432/fenwyn

Action item from the Lintervale locker incident: the access flow must never leave a door unlatched while the reservation record is being written. We will make the latch release strictly follow a committed reservation, add an idempotency guard on repeated unlock taps, and shorten the grace window during which a stale code still works. Future maintainers should note that all three timers interact — changing one without the others reopens the race. The agreed timer and retry constants are recorded below.

tuning table, kajog-bawip:
TIERS = {
    "kelius": 256,
    "lammir": 543,
}

## Ownership

Quick note for plugin folks: the Tidewren SDKs for Kestrel and Marrow runtimes are supposed to be feature-identical, but in practice Marrow lags a release or two. If your plugin hits a method that exists in one SDK and not the other, that's a parity gap, not a you problem — file it against the parity tracker instead of working around it. Parity gaps get triaged weekly. The person who owns that triage and signs off on gaps is named below.

approver of faduf-bagug = Framir Sorwyn

## Orders Table: Soft-Delete Limits

In the Cinderlane order service, rows are never hard-deleted immediately; a tombstone flag is set and a sweeper reclaims space later. New engineers should note that sweeper throughput is deliberately capped to protect replication lag. The sweeper's behavior is controlled by the constants shown below.

constants for bawif-kawif:
QUOTAS = {
    "ulaael": 5,
    "holael": 10,
}